I can also recall a couple of movies

 

"The Right Stuff" which includes much footage of the early jet age apart from its main story having to do with the original space race. http://www.imdb.com/title/tt0086197/

 

I remember another movie not very well known called "Red Flag" and its story is based in post vietnam era USA, Nellis AFB, where to old flightmates fron the vietnam war go through training facing each other. Not a good movie, but very accurate footage o f phantoms and F-5's in ACM training. http://www.imdb.com/title/tt0082978/
